I don't immediately see anything that would cause a problem. Depending on
how the VDIF threads are recorded (separate files or interlaced into one
file) there might be a setup change needed (two datasteams per telescope,
one per VDIF file, rather than just one datastream as would be the case for
interlaced VDIF).  I don't think point 3) needs any changes, if there are
channels in these stations that are not present at other stations they just
wouldn't be correlated.

> Hi All,
> We received a message about an upgrade to the digital backend for Russian
> geodetic VLBI stations and then describe the frequency setup like this:
>
>
>    1. VDIF output format (instead of Mark5B+)
>    2. Each frequency range has its own VDIF data stream, i.e. for S/X
>    mode will be two VDIF streams (instead of one like Mark5B+)
>    3. The number of DBBCs used in each frequency range must be a multiple
>    of 2, i.e. standard geodetic mode will be 8 USB channels in S and 8 USB or
>    16 channels (8 USB+ 2 LSB + 6 any) in X (instead of 6 USB in S & 8 USB + 2
>    LSB in X)
>
>
> The question is can DiFX handle this setup?  I'm pretty sure the answer is
> yes (for the 3rd item we might need to use dummy channels or some other
> sort of trick).  Does anyone see any glaring issues?
